An Alien Registration Number, also known as an A-number or USCIS number, is a unique identification number assigned by USCIS to individuals for tracking immigration files. It is typically found on documents from USCIS, such as a green card, and is usually a seven to nine-digit number. Only permanent residents and certain nonimmigrants granted specific benefits receive an A-number. If you have a green card, you can find your Alien Registration Number on the front side, often listed as underneath USCIS#. Older green cards may have the number in different locations.

Use clear silicone or exterior construction adhesive to mount the numbers. Choose one number, do a quick dry-fit one more time, then fill the drill holes for that number with adhesive or silicone.
When youre mounting house numbers on brick, you have two main options: Drilling into the brick or mortar with a masonry drill bit to secure masonry anchors. This requires some experience and patience. Using a construction adhesive like Gorilla Glue requires no drilling and just a little bit of water and tape.
A: Devices called brick clips or brick hangers allow people to hang pictures, mirrors and other objects on walls without drilling into the brick. Two examples are Brick Clips by a company called Tuopu (10 for $14.99 on Amazon) and OOK Brick Hangers (two for $2.48 at Home Depot).

Attaching house numbers to brick - what to do Take a pack of FIX-PRO Outdoor Mounting Tape and cut a piece to size. Stick the tape to the back of the house number and press it down firmly. Peel off the backing plastic. Press the house number firmly against the brick to secure it in place.

How to a house number plaque on vinyl siding? Drill screws through the siding, into the sheathing, to secure the plaque. Obtain some sort of vinyl siding hook, and use it to hang the plaque on top of the siding.
